I’m pleased to share with my colleagues news about additional funding that strengthens the safety and security of hard-working families in Whitby and other parts of the region of Durham.

Our government, with the leadership of Premier Ford and the Solicitor General, has provided $900,000 over three years to support the hard-working officers of the Durham Regional Police Service in their efforts to combat and prevent auto thefts. This funding is part of our government’s groundbreaking Preventing Auto Thefts Grant Program focused on prevention, detection, analysis and enforcement. A total investment of $18 million over three years is being allocated to 21 police projects to collectively tackle the rising issue of auto theft. This funding equips our police services, like the Durham Regional Police Service, with the tools necessary to enhance prevention, improve investigations, and gather evidence to put criminals where they belong—in jail.

Since 2018, approximately $15 million has been provided by our government to the Durham Regional Police Service.
